AI Meets Human Brain: The Core Findings
The research team systematically disrupted a large language model and analyzed the errors produced during these disruptions. Using a robust dataset drawn from chronic post-stroke patients (N=410), they demonstrated a statistical correspondence between the error patterns of AI and those found in humans suffering from stroke-induced aphasia. It turns out that when AI stumbles, it mimics human failure in understanding language—like calling a 'horse' a 'dog'. This alignment goes beyond coincidence; we're talking about strong statistical significance (p < 10?²³).
“For the first time, we have an external, biologically grounded reference for understanding AI language processing,” said Julius Fridriksson, CEO of ALLT. AI.
This finding isn't merely interesting—it could reshape how we think about efficiency in AI. Traditional model compression relies on brute-force approaches where engineers strip down parameters without any grounding in biological validity. But with BLUM's framework mapping these breakdowns onto established neural pathways, researchers can identify which components are truly essential for functionality.

The Digital Twin Potential
Here’s where things get really intriguing: envision patient-specific digital twins modeled after individuals with conditions such as aphasia or dementia using this framework! By recognizing patterns of disruption specific to individual patients through the lens of their errors within the model, researchers could simulate deficits effectively while also modeling disease progression.
